从授权到收回:TP钱包撤销策略与智能合约安全路径

取消TP钱包授权转账应当是一次兼顾可操作性与系统设计的行为,既要把握具体步骤,也要理解底层风险与改进方向。

操作指引:1) 在TP钱包内进入“资产”或“安全/授权管理”查看已授权合约;2) 选择需要撤销的代币授予,点击“撤销”或将额度改为0;3) 若钱包不显示授权,可使用第三方工具(如Revoke.cash或区块链浏览器的Approve接口)签名并提交撤销交易;4) 检查链上交易状态与哈希,保存证据以备追溯。

高性能数据存储:钱包前端应缓存授权状态与交易索引,后端用时序数据库或高效Key-Value(如RocksDB/LevelDB)构建快速查询层,同时将链上事件索引到搜索引擎以支持实时过滤与历史回溯。

可追溯性:每次撤销必须记录交易哈希、区块编号、时间戳与操作员标识,采用不可篡改日志(可用区块链或Merkle树摘要上链)确保审计链完整。

安全身份认证:优先支持助记词硬件隔离、硬件钱包签名、系统级生物认证与多签控制。撤销关键操作建议二次验证与事务预签名策略。

手续费设置:界面应提供快捷档位与自定义Gas功能,提示成本估算并支持代付或打包撤销(批量撤销聚合交易以摊薄Gas)。

智能合约平台设计:优选支持可撤销授予模式、ERC-2612/Permit等免Gas授权、Allowance Registry模式与时间锁限制;设计时考虑最小权限、可回滚及事件透明。

创新型数字路径:推动基于签名的离线授权与账户抽象(ERC-4337)组合,允许用户用一次签名批量管理多链授权;利用零知识证明隐私保护敏感操作记录。

专家评估分析:从权衡看,增强撤销能力会增加链上成本,但显著降低长期风险;系统设计应把用户体验作为首要入口,用智能合约标准与链下索引补足可追溯与性能需求。

按上述步骤与设计原则执行,既能完成TP钱包授权撤销,也能为今后授权管理建立更安全、可审计的体系。

作者:梁一鸣发布时间:2025-12-19 13:01:08

评论

相关阅读